Budget-Friendly Interior Design Tips for a 4 BHK Flat

1. Minimalist Design for a Spacious Look

A clutter-free home with minimal furniture and decor enhances the space. Focus on clean lines, neutral colors, and multipurpose furniture to maintain aesthetics while saving costs.

2. Use Cost-Effective Materials

  • Opt for laminates instead of expensive wooden finishes.
  • Use MDF or plywood instead of solid wood.
  • Go for ceramic tiles rather than marble or granite.
  • Choose wallpaper or textured paint over costly designer wall panels.

3. DIY Decor and Upcycling

  • Repurpose old furniture with fresh paint or new upholstery.
  • Use DIY art and crafts for wall decor.
  • Repurpose mason jars, old crates, and glass bottles as decorative elements.

4. Affordable Furniture Choices

  • Look for second-hand or refurbished furniture in Gurgaon and Delhi markets.
  • Buy furniture during sales or opt for local carpenters instead of branded stores.
  • Invest in modular furniture that serves multiple purposes.

5. Lighting Enhancements on a Budget

  • Use LED lights to reduce energy costs.
  • Opt for decorative fairy lights, paper lanterns, or simple pendant lights for a modern look.
  • Use natural light by installing sheer curtains instead of heavy drapes.

6. Smart Storage Solutions

  • Use vertical shelves and wall-mounted racks to save space.
  • Install under-bed storage and multi-purpose furniture.
  • Use baskets, storage ottomans, and modular wardrobes to organize your space efficiently.

Room-by-Room Low-Budget Interior Design Ideas

Living Room Design Ideas

  • Use light-colored paint to make the room appear bigger.
  • Arrange furniture strategically to maximize space.
  • Add a statement rug or wall art for an elegant touch.
  • Opt for a simple TV unit with floating shelves.

Bedroom Design Ideas

  • Use neutral bedding with colorful cushions for contrast.
  • Install wall-mounted bedside tables to save space.
  • Opt for simple curtains with elegant patterns.
  • Create an accent wall with wallpaper or wall decals.

Kitchen Design Ideas

  • Use open shelving instead of closed cabinets.
  • Paint old cabinets for a fresh look instead of replacing them.
  • Add budget-friendly LED strip lights under cabinets for a modern touch.
  • Use glass jars and organizers to keep the kitchen neat.

Bathroom Design Ideas

  • Use wall-mounted shelves for toiletries to save space.
  • Install a large mirror to make the bathroom look bigger.
  • Choose affordable yet stylish bathroom accessories.
  • Opt for waterproof wallpaper instead of expensive tiles.

FAQs on Budget 4 BHK Interior Design

Q1: How can I decorate my 4 BHK flat on a budget?
A: Use DIY decor, shop smart, upcycle old furniture, and focus on minimalistic design to save costs.

Q2: Where can I buy affordable home decor in Delhi NCR?
A: Check markets like Sarojini Nagar, Sadar Bazaar, and online platforms like Flipkart and Amazon.

Q3: How can I make my flat look luxurious without spending much?
A: Use mirrors to create an illusion of space, invest in statement lighting, and incorporate stylish yet affordable furniture.

Q4: What color schemes work best for a modern budget home?
A: Neutral shades like beige, white, and grey with pops of color through decor items work best.
